Gudrun Gut is Berlin-music royalty. She has been at the heart of so many influential movements and projects, it’s hard to summarise her three-decade career. A founding member of Einstürzende Neubauten, she went on to form the legendary outfits Mania D and Malaria!, whose work influenced generations of powerful feminist post-punk. As the head of Monika Enterprises, she released a wave of exploratory artists. For her performance with Andrew Tuttle at Mono, she layers audio and visual materials to create a throbbing mixed-media experience.
